General Description

1-ISOPROPYL-5-METHYL-1H-PYRAZOLE-4-CARBOXYLIC ACID, also known as 4-isopropyl-1-methyl-1H-pyrazole-4-carboxylic acid, is a chemical compound with the molecular formula C8H12N2O2. It is a pyrazole derivative, which is commonly used as a building block in the synthesis of pharmaceuticals and agrochemicals. 1-ISOPROPYL-5-METHYL-1H-PYRAZOLE-4-CARBOXYLIC ACID has potential applications in the pharmaceutical industry due to its ability to modulate biological processes, such as enzyme inhibition, which makes it a promising candidate for drug development. Additionally, it exhibits various biological activities, such as anti-inflammatory and antiviral properties. The compound's chemical structure and properties make it a valuable tool for medicinal and agricultural research and development.

Check Digit Verification of cas no

The CAS Registry Mumber 1007541-94-7 includes 10 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 7 digits, 1,0,0,7,5,4 and 1 respectively; the second part has 2 digits, 9 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 1007541-94:
(9*1)+(8*0)+(7*0)+(6*7)+(5*5)+(4*4)+(3*1)+(2*9)+(1*4)=117
117 % 10 = 7
So 1007541-94-7 is a valid CAS Registry Number.

KCNT1 INHIBITORS AND METHODS OF USE

-

Paragraph 000351, (2020/11/23)

The present invention is directed to, in part, compounds and compositions useful for preventing and/or treating a neurological disease or disorder, a disease or condition relating to excessive neuronal excitability, and/or a gain-of-function mutation in a gene (e.g., KCNT1). Methods of treating a neurological disease or disorder, a disease or condition relating to excessive neuronal excitability, and/or a gain-of-function mutation in a gene such as KCNT1 are also provided herein.
